To elaborate further, most motor wire is rated to ~500-600 volts, if there is 0 damage to wire coating. the process of wrapping a core tends to bang up the coating a bit. Also the higher the frequency, (faster switching) the more ‘leaky’ the voltage is. a motor with a visible corona is a beautiful, terrifying thing if you are riding it.

My personal limit for hobby grade motor is ~70v DC. The few times I played with greater voltage than that with hobby motors didn’t work well, and let out the magic smoke at voltages > 100v DC
